Slovenia - Export of Full Grains and Full Grain Splits Of Bovine and Equine Animals

Since 2014, Slovenia Export of Full Grains and Full Grain Splits Of Bovine and Equine Animals jumped by 20.4% year on year. At $55,805,316.19 in 2019, the country was ranked number 25 among other countries in Export of Full Grains and Full Grain Splits Of Bovine and Equine Animals. Slovenia is overtaken by Japan, which was ranked number 24 with $68,851,712 and is followed by Romania with $53,914,779.53. Italy ranked the highest with $2,256,608,270.87 in 2019, a fall of 0.1% versus 2018. Brazil, Germany and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kyrgyzstan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+91.2% per year, while Namibia witnessed the worst performance at -81.5% per year.
